]> git.baikalelectronics.ru Git - kernel.git/commit
drm/i915: Clear self-refresh watermarks when disabled
authorChris Wilson <chris@chris-wilson.co.uk>
Fri, 7 Dec 2012 10:43:24 +0000 (10:43 +0000)
committerDaniel Vetter <daniel.vetter@ffwll.ch>
Mon, 17 Dec 2012 11:38:45 +0000 (12:38 +0100)
commitf317fe65bd119752eb565ca24e44c352e1200145
treed43b37193ef1ec58395304a4c585423a6bba1c3f
parenta4f92d258f07440db799ab93a77736dec680eee7
drm/i915: Clear self-refresh watermarks when disabled

If we elect to disable self-refresh as they require too many FIFO
entries, clear the values prior to writing them into the registers. If
they are too large they may occupy more bits than available and so
corrupt neighbouring WM values.

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
Reviewed-by: Jesse Barnes <jbarnes@virtuousgeek.org>
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
drivers/gpu/drm/i915/intel_pm.c